Navigating Oregon's Buildout and Expansion Process

Expanding or remodeling a food business in Oregon involves specific local processes that impact financing. The permitting sequence often requires a detailed review of plans for health, safety, and zoning compliance before construction begins. This multi-stage approval can introduce delays, making precise financial planning crucial for managing cash flow throughout the project.

Financing for buildout and expansion must account for these regulatory timelines. A draw schedule, where funds are released as project milestones are met and inspections passed, aligns with the typical permitting and construction sequence. This structure ensures capital is available when needed without incurring interest on the full amount prematurely, providing financial flexibility during the build phase.

Cost Drivers for Oregon Food Businesses

Several factors drive costs for Oregon food businesses undertaking buildouts or expansions. Rent pressure, particularly in urban areas like Portland and Multnomah County, remains a significant consideration for new locations or renegotiated leases. This impacts the overall project budget and the required financing amount.

Buildout pricing is influenced by local labor costs and material availability. Specific requirements for seismic upgrades or sustainable building practices, common in the Pacific Census division, can also add to construction expenses. Financing must cover these comprehensive costs, from initial demolition to final fixture installation, with amounts ranging from 50,000 to 2,000,000.

Additionally, utility load requirements for commercial kitchens can necessitate substantial infrastructure upgrades, impacting both initial buildout costs and ongoing operational expenses. Competition for skilled labor also affects project timelines and costs, making efficient project management and robust financing essential for successful completion.
